  • Title

    On estimation of snow water equivalence using L-band and Ku-band radar

  • Abstract
    The study of snow has become an important area of research in the natural sciences, particularly in hydrology and climatology. This study shows a concept of estimating snow water equivalence under the consideration of a dual frequency L- and Ku-band polarization system.
